The errors shown in Table
8.4 are indicated by the AD71 "HOLD"
LED. E K O ~
5 0
or 51 indicate a hardware failure.
A bus error may be due
to a hardware failure or to the sequence
program accessing too much of the buffer memory too frequently.
In the case of the latter, the sequence program must be changed in
order to allow sufficient time for the AD71 to access the buffer
memory between buffer
+
PC transactions.

In the event of any of the above errors occurring 1) turn off the
AD71 ready (X11 and
2)
force BUSY processing to stop. The start
signal is then not accepted.
8.1.3 Buffer memory write errors
Writing data from the sequence program to prohibited buffer addres-
ses
or writing when the buffer cannot accept the data prompts the
error codes shown in Table
8.5.
